One-Dimensional (1D) Nanostructured Materials Market Size

The global One-Dimensional (1D) Nanostructured Materials market was valued at US$ 1540 million in 2025 and is anticipated to reach US$ 2248 million by 2032, at a CAGR of 5.6% from 2026 to 2032.

One-Dimensional (1D) Nanostructured Materials are materials with two dimensions confined to the nanometer scale (1-100 nm) and a much larger third dimension, appearing as wires, rods, fibers, or tubes, giving them high surface areas and unique electronic, optical, and catalytic properties for applications in electronics, energy, and medicine. Examples include nanowires, nanotubes (like carbon nanotubes), nanorods, and nanobelts, which offer enhanced performance due to their large surface-to-volume ratio and efficient charge transport pathways.
In 2025, the global output of one-dimensional nanostructure materials is estimated at 55,000 tons, with an average price of US$28/kg and a gross profit margin typically ranging from 45% to 70%.
The upstream of one-dimensional nanostructured materials mainly includes high-purity metal and semiconductor precursors, carbon sources, functional polymers, catalysts, specialty gases, and solvents, which determine the size control, crystallinity, and electrical and mechanical properties of nanowires, nanotubes, and nanorods. Downstream applications are the key to value creation, with electronics and semiconductors being the most critical segment, where 1D nanomaterials are used in transistors, interconnects, sensors, and flexible electronics to achieve higher carrier mobility, smaller device dimensions, and lower power consumption. The energy sector is another major application area, as 1D nanostructures in lithium-ion and sodium-ion batteries, supercapacitors, and fuel cells provide shorter ion diffusion paths and larger surface area, improving capacity, rate performance, and cycle life. In optoelectronics and displays, their anisotropic structures and quantum confinement effects are exploited in photodetectors, light-emitting devices, and emerging display architectures. In biomedicine, 1D nanomaterials are applied in biosensing, drug delivery, and tissue engineering scaffolds, emphasizing high sensitivity, biocompatibility, and functional tunability. Advanced composites and structural reinforcement also represent important downstream markets, where nanofibers and nanotubes enhance strength, conductivity, and durability in aerospace, automotive, and construction materials. In terms of trends, 1D nanostructured materials are moving toward scalable, controllable, and cost-effective production, with increasing emphasis on green synthesis and material safety, and deeper integration with flexible electronics, wearable devices, and next-generation energy systems. Key drivers include continued miniaturization in microelectronics, rapid growth in energy storage and renewable energy demand, advances in high-sensitivity sensing and precision medicine, and expanding industrial use of high-performance lightweight materials. Constraints include complex fabrication processes, challenges in batch consistency and reliability control, relatively high costs, and limited standardization and long-term safety evaluation in some applications.
